Just FYI, in BETA3 I made it optional to visit the Pool Type menu.
You can actually just hit "Install" and it will notice that you haven't
visited that menu yet and prompt you to select type and disks.
Makes testing faster because I don't have to cursor-down, enter,
select type/disks, cursor up, enter; instead just enter and select
type/disks.
